Einladung SOI Workshops 2014

workshop.jpg

Wir laden Dich zu unseren beiden Workshop-Weekends für die erste Runde ein. Sie sind die ideale Gelegenheit, um in die erste Runde der SOI einzusteigen. Wir werden ein Programm anbieten für Einsteiger, und eines für Fortgeschrittene, d.h. egal ob du noch gar keine oder schon sehr viele Vorkenntnisse hast, wirst du viel profitieren könnnen.

Es gibt Vorlesungen und praktische Übungen am Computer, wo du das Gelernte gleich in einem selbst geschriebenen Programm ausprobieren kannst, und Fragen stellen kannst, wenn etwas nicht funktionieren sollte.

Der Einsteiger-Track wird ungefähr folgende Themen beinhalten: Was ist ein Algorithmus, wie gehe ich an eine Aufgabe heran, Laufzeit-Analyse, Big-O Notation, Einführung ins Programmieren in C++, Input/Output in C++, C++ im Linux-Terminal kompilieren, for-Loops, Datentypen, Funktionen, Arrays, Standard Template Library, binäre Suche, Backtracking-Algorithmen, Kombinatorik und Zahlentheorie, Einstieg in die Graphentheorie, eventuell auch Dynamische Programmierung.

Mit den fortgeschrittenen Teilnehmenden werden wir Themen behandeln wie Geometrie-Algorithmen (Grundlagen, Konvexe Hülle, Scanline-Algorithmen), Dynamische Programmierung, Graphenalgorithmen (Union Find, Minimum Spanning Tree, Dijkstras Algorithmus), Divide & Conquer, Segment-Bäume, und Diskrete Mathematik (Gruppen, Multiplikative Inverse, Relationen, Beweistechniken, Induktion).

Daten

Die Workshops finden an folgenden zwei Wochenenden statt:

  • Freitag 17.10.2014 09.30h – Sonntag 19.10.2014 17h, an der ETH Zürich, mit Übernachtung in der Jugendherberge Zürich
  • Freitag 31.10.2014 17.00h – Sonntag 02.10.2014 17h, an der EPF Lausanne, mit Übernachtung in der Jugendherberge Lausanne

Die beiden Wochenenden werden sich thematisch ergänzen. Du kannst also an beiden Wochenenden oder auch nur an einem teilnehmen.

Sprachen

Sowohl in Zürich wie auch in Lausanne werden wir Deutsch, Französisch, und evtl. Englisch sprechen, d.h. es reicht, wenn du eine dieser Sprachen verstehst.

Mitbringen

Du solltest, falls irgendwie möglich, einen eigenen Laptop mitnehmen, und gcc (der C++ Kompiler, den wir verwenden werden) installieren. Du wirst genauere Anweisungen dazu nach der Anmeldung erhalten.

Verpflegung, Unterkunft, Kosten

Wir werden jeweils auf dem Campus Zmittag essen, Abendessen und Frühstück in der Jugendherberge. Snacks und Getränke für zwischendurch werden bereit stehen.

Dank unseren Unterstützungspartnern übernimmt die SOI die Kosten für Verpflegung und Jugendherberge, und die Reisekosten werden zum Halbtax-Preis zurückerstattet.

Anmeldung

Interessiert? Dann fülle bitte das Anmeldeformular aus. Am besten noch heute, denn die Teilnehmerzahl ist beschränkt, und wir werden die Anmeldungen in der Reihenfolge des Anmeldedatums berücksichtigen.

Bei Fragen sind wir unter info@soi.ch erreichbar.

Wir freuen uns, Dich bald in Zürich oder Lausanne begrüssen zu dürfen!

Samuel Grütter, Daniel Graf, im Namen des SOI-Teams